Q: A customer says Fixturely, our test-data factory library, refuses to regenerate seed fixtures after a license reset. What do we tell them? A: This is expected. After any license reset, Fixturely locks its seed cache to prevent silent data drift, and the cache must be unlocked manually from the admin CLI. Walk the customer through running the unlock command, which will prompt for the recovery passphrase given just below.

vault phrase of bagaf-kajeg = jorath-feniel-briir-siliel-ralix

Hey — handing off the Pavion kiosk watchdog to you for the week. It's been stable, but it restarts the shell app if heartbeats stall, so don't panic at reboot logs. One kiosk in the Delmore lobby flaps occasionally; just acknowledge it. The watchdog's current settings, in case you need to tweak, are below.

settings of bawif-fawif:
ralix:
  log_level: warn
  metrics_host: metrics.ralix.tolvaqsys.internal
  pool_size: 32

Quick note on how Lanternbook stores events: everything in `evt_core` is partitioned by calendar month, so a query scoped to one month only touches one partition. That matters for your review because retention jobs drop whole partitions rather than deleting rows — no tombstones, no partial erasure states. Partitions older than 13 months are detached and archived to cold storage by the Mothwing job. The access controls and encryption settings per partition are documented on the internal data-handling page.

dashboard of bafof-hafog = https://confluence.lumiclabs.internal/display/browse/display/6a09a20a

Subject: New "Lumenis Plus" tier — heads up

Hi all,

Quick note before Friday's sync: we're greenlighting the Lumenis Plus subscription tier for a soft launch in the Marovia region. Pricing lands between Core and Atelier, with the analytics bundle included. Tove's team has the onboarding flow nearly done, and support scripts go out next week. Keep this within your departments for now, as it ties into the item below.

internal memo for fajog-yagaf: Gross margin on Ulaael came in at 20 percent against a plan of 10 percent. Only 9 of the 80 pilot accounts renewed Ulaael, so a churn review is set for July 1.